Manjaro is a populated settlement in the Issuna (Isuna) ward of Ikungi District of the Singida Region of Tanzania.[1] It lies approximately 40 miles (64 km) south of the town of Singida and about 80 miles (130 km) north east of the national capital Dodoma.
